2000-2001 DODGE RAM PICKUP HOOD LATCH Defect Investigation for the 2000 Ram
Vehicle Component: Latches/Locks/Linkages:Hood:Latch*
Summary: The Agency opened this investigation based on 30 complaints alleging that the hoods on model year (MY) 2000 and 2001 Dodge Ram pickup trucks flew up and blocked the driver's vision. These vehicles have a primary hood latch and a secondary (backup) hood latch. The secondary latch is designed to secure the hood if the primary hood latch is not properly closed or otherwise malfunctions. In these complaints, the secondary hood latch malfunctioned, apparently due to corrosion, and did not latch. Dodge conducted recall 01V-040 in 1999 to address similar problems on model year 1994-1997 Dodge Ram pickup trucks. The information Chrysler provided in response to ODI's information request letter indicated that the MY 2000 and 2001 vehicles were equipped with secondary hood latches with stainless steel return springs, as opposed to the earlier recalled trucks that had zinc coated carbon steel return springs. The recalled components were susceptible to corrosion-induced failure due to the type of material used, whereas the corrosion failures in the newer models appear to be due to lubrication loss over time (regular application of grease is advised per instructions in the owners' manual). ODI's review of Chrysler's warranty, complaint, and injury data for the 2000 and 2001 vehicles indicates that the rates for subject vehicles are low and are declining. A potential defect trend has not been identified. This investigation is closed.
More Details: For detailed information & supporting documents, see the official NHTSA page concerning investigation #PE08047 »
Status of Investigation: This investigation was closed on December 17 2008 and no recall was issued.
